Road Kings from 2006 and 2011 are up for grabs. Sirens not included.

Now is your chance for you and a buddy to re-enact the “CHiPs” movie. The Texarkana Arkansas Police Department (TAPD) has two used Harleys up for auction, reports KKYR. Bids are being accepted on a 2006 Road King FLHP with 28,531 miles, and a 2011 Road King FLHP with 34,000 miles.

According to the TAPD facebook page, the motorcycles will be sold without lights and sirens and “as is with no warranty.” TAPD also says that bids must be submitted in writing and received by March 18, 2019. If you live in the area, the motorcycles may be viewed by appointment.

Located in Bowie County, the TAPD serves a population of about 30,000 with 81 officers.

Harley-Davidson says their police motorcycles are known the world over as the vehicle of choice for those who protect and serve.

The 2019 Harley-Davidson Road King has certainly been upgraded compared to the older models. New bikes feature the Milwaukee-Eight V-Twin engine and high-performing front and rear suspension. Also included are easy open saddlebags and Brembo brakes that provide exactly the right amount of braking to each tire.
